David joined SCVC in 2002 and has been carving with us every week. We are glad to share his diverse woodcarving gallery.

David carved a 9″ (23 cm) tall fisherman from basswood. The fish was carved separately and glued to the body. This project shows David’s attention to detail and skill with the medium.

David’s whittling projects always draw a crowd at our public events; kids and adults alike marvel at the intricate chains he carved from a single block of wood.

Classic whittling projects: wooden chains, ball-in-cage projects, and a working folding pocket knife. They are carved from basswood and pine. Shared in David's woodcarving gallery.
A delicate spoon carved and stained by David Osterlund. David won the Best of Show award at the Tri-Valley Carvers show in 2025 for this grape leaf spoon.

Congratulations to David for earning a Best of Show award at the Tri-Valley Carvers Woodcarving Show with his stunning Grape Leaf Love Spoon in 2025.

David carved an intricate spoon from butternut, once again proving his ability to craft beautiful and delicate items. It is ~12” long. Summer 2025

A Santa and three Viking warriors, carved and painted by David Osterlund. The photo was taken for the SCVC woodcarving newsletter.

David carved dozens of Old World Santas and Viking Warriors.
